How to overcome communication challenges
1. Introduction
Hey there! Let us embark on a journey into the fascinating realm of tech skills and explore why communication plays a pivotal, yet often overlooked, role in the world of software development. It is not merely about coding; it is about fostering meaningful conversations within your team, understanding one another, and ensuring that the ground-breaking project you’re working on sees the light of day.
Let me tell you one Story,
Once upon a time in the world of data science exploration, there was a diverse team unravelling the mysteries hidden within vast datasets. Annyce, a seasoned data scientist, cherished the idea of ensuring everyone spoke the same data language. She shared her insights through stories of a team facing a data glitch. Instead of playing the blame game, they gathered to discuss facts. Annyce imparted the wisdom of sending out data analyses early to cover all time zones, and when face-to-face meetings were not feasible, they over-communicated online to bridge the gap. She stressed the importance of understanding diverse perspectives, treating colleagues like friends rather than co-workers. The team learned not to assign blame but to extract valuable lessons. Their journey was marked by small victories, gradual insights, and a supportive atmosphere. In this data-driven tale, they realized that clear communication was the unsung hero, transforming data challenges into opportunities. Therefore, the team embraced the power of dialogue, learning, and growing together, making their data science adventure a resounding success.
2. Handle Challenges in Communication
Imagine this: You are knee-deep in data science development, juggling tasks that go beyond just lines of code. You are interfacing with stakeholders, developers, product managers, and testers, each with their unique perspectives on how things should unfold. Annyce Davis, armed with her LinkedIn learning course, is here to guide you on elevating your communication game to new heights, making your tech skills truly shine.
3. Upgrade Your Technical Communication
In addition, hey, this is not exclusively for the coders among us. Whether you are a product manager, a tester, or anyone contributing to a software team, Annyce’s course has your back. It is not about complex theories or jargon; it is about practical and tested techniques and strategies to ensure everyone in the team is on the same wavelength. Real-world examples? Absolutely!
4. Communicating Across Cultures
Ever found yourself in a meeting where it felt like everyone was speaking the same language, yet something was amiss? Annyce knows that feeling all too well. Working in The Netherlands with a diverse team, she has encountered challenges stemming from cultural differences. The key? Building relationships, providing context, using visuals, and embracing an understanding of different cultural norms. It is like a crash course in global teamwork, where diversity becomes a strength rather than a hurdle.
5. Communicating Across Time Zones
Now, if your team is scattered across the globe, time zones can be a logistical nightmare. Annyce suggests some practical solutions. For meetings, send out the agenda well in advance, and perhaps consider having everyone show their faces for the first few minutes to foster a sense of connection. For day-to-day interactions, the mantra is over-communication. If you think you have shared enough, go ahead and share a bit more. It is about keeping everyone in the loop even when separated by miles or time zones.
6. When Something Goes Wrong
Projects are akin to roller coasters – they have their highs and lows. But how you navigate the lows is crucial. Annyce weaves a tale of a team grappling with a botched launch. Rather than engaging in the blame game, they focus on facts, avoid pointing fingers, and collaboratively devise strategies to do better next time. It is about turning setbacks into opportunities for learning, without harbouring resentment.
7. Conclusions
As we draw the curtains on this exploration of communication in the tech world, let us reflect on some key takeaways and practical steps to enhance your communication skills:
- Start Small: Improving communication does not necessitate a massive overhaul. Begin by identifying one area, be it code reviews, meeting structures, or on boarding processes, and apply the techniques discussed.
- Apply Lessons Gradually: Do not feel pressured to implement all the strategies at once. Take it step by step, applying what you have learned in a measured and sustainable manner.
- Embrace the Journey: Communication improvement is an ongoing journey. Celebrate small victories, learn from challenges, and continuously refine your approach.
- Build a Supportive Environment: Encourage open communication within your team. Create an atmosphere where team members feel comfortable expressing ideas, asking questions, and sharing concerns.
- Cultural Sensitivity: In a globalized work environment, understanding and respecting diverse cultures can significantly enhance collaboration. Foster an environment where cultural differences are valued and leveraged for collective success.
- Adaptability: Tech and communication landscapes evolve. Stay open to adopting new tools and methodologies that can streamline communication and contribute to team efficiency.
8. Thoughts
Improving your communication skills is not merely a professional enhancement; it is a game-changer. Imagine leaving a meeting with a smile because everyone is on the same page. Annyce believes that investing a bit more time in communication processes can save you from a world of miscommunication. It is not about doing everything at once; it is about starting small and witnessing the transformative impact on team dynamics.
Therefore, there you have it – a deep dive into the synergy of tech skills and effective communication. As you navigate your tech career, remember that fostering clear and meaningful communication is a skill set that transcends coding languages. It is about connecting with your team, navigating challenges, and collectively steering toward success. Cheers to improved communication and the exciting journey ahead!